Indian IT Minister ahead Burma
By Surajit Khaund
Mizzima News(www.mizzima.com)
August 10, 2003: Encouraged with growing volume of trade
between India and Burma, the Indian Information and Telecom
Minister Arun Shourie is visiting Burma newt month to improve
the bilateral relations between the countries.
Telecom sources today informed the Mizzima correspondent
today that during his visit, Mr. Shouries will have a wide
range of talks with his Burmese counterpart and the traders
for exploring potential of information technology in Burma.
" Burma recently has shown keen interest in the information
technology sector. Moreover several Indian companies are keen
to invest in Burma keeping in view potential in the country",
the sources added.
They further informed that India wanted to carry forward
trade and commerce with Burma in a bid to emerge as a leader
in the Southeast Asian countries.
Giving more information about the visit, they said that the
minister is also keen explore the potential of telecommunication
sector which is a major leader in the Asian countries. The
minister is likely to be accompanied by a big delegation of
the Indian traders.
